Easy Timer allows you to easily insert into posts, pages and widgets of your website an unlimited number of count down/up timers that refresh every second, and the time or date. Each countdown timer shows the time remaining until the date you choose, and, if you want, reveals a hidden content when this date is reached. Each countup timer shows the time elapsed since the date you choose or the time spent by the Internet user on the webpage.
